CPCS TANKER & JETTING TANKER OPERATIVE
Location: Croydon
Job Purpose:
To achieve the department objectives in line with the corporate strategy and vision for which the job holder is directly responsible and continuously improves performance. To assist the Operations Manager in the delivery of Tanker operations for the London South Waste Network Contract.
Principal Accountabilities / Objectives:
To carry out three monthly van & equipment audits reporting any defects to the operations manager.
To carry out daily internal and external vehicle & equipment checks reporting any defects to the operations manager out the south London area
Ensure all personnel are smart and conform to the company standards
Ensure the yard, mess and external areas are kept clean & tidy via a rota system
To assist the Operations Manager in the resolution of any disputes that may arise
To actively contribute to the development of new systems and best practice
To promote customer excellence ensuring a quality and professional service is given at all times
Dealing with drainage works at domestic, commercial and private sites.
To deliver a high standard of customer service at all times.
Completion of site specific risk assessments on all sites, providing accurate and effective feedback and plans.
Report to management any defects in equipment, materials and report to management all accidents, dangerous occurrences and near misses,
Uses equipment for the purpose which it was intended as long as training has been undertaken for the equipment.
Maintains tools and equipment to ensure that they are fit for purpose and are in good condition.
To carry out plant and stock check on a weekly basis.
Conducting Jet vac and tankering operations throughout WNS region
Working on busy roads in & around London
Reference To Other Documents:
Delivery against contract KPI/SPI targets
Competency: Skills/Knowledge/Qualifications:
LGV Combination tanker driver with C entitlement, DIGI-CARD and relevant experience.
Previous experience on drain cleansing using high pressure water jetting machines preferred.
Duties include transportation of liquid solid wastes in combination tankers, transportation to registered disposal sites, attending emergency callout's for flooding and sewer problems.
We operate a 24/7 service, you will be included on a call out rota to include weekends and nights, which requires flexibility.
